Compound Interest

A method of interest computation that involves charging interest on the original loan or deposit amount as well as on any interest that has built up during past periods.

Time Value

The principle that having money in the present is more valuable than having the same sum in the future because of its ability to generate earnings.

Capital Investment Analysis

The process of assessing the financial viability of a long-term investment project or proposal, evaluating potential returns and risks.

Money

A medium of exchange that facilitates trade, typically issued by a government as legal tender.
